A bright one-bedroom Victorian conversion on Stoke Newington High Street, offered chain-free with a long 999-year lease and a share of the freehold. The flat sits on a mid-terrace building and delivers wooden floors, double-glazed windows and high ceilings that preserve period character while feeling light and roomy. The separate living room and modern bathroom make it a comfortable starter home for a single professional or couple.

Location is a key selling point: Clissold Park, Hackney Downs and Stoke Newington’s cafés and shops are within easy walking distance. Rectory Road and Stoke Newington Overground stations are under half a mile away, providing quick links into the City for commuters. Council tax is in a low band, and broadband and mobile signal are strong.

Buyers should note a few material drawbacks. There’s no private outdoor space or balcony, the building has solid brick walls likely without cavity insulation, and crime levels in the area are reported as high. The flat’s kitchen is compact, and the wider neighbourhood is classed as deprived — factors to weigh against the property’s strong transport and local-amenity offer.

This home suits a first-time buyer or investor looking for an inner-London pied-à-terre with immediate access to green space and transport. It offers clear potential to personalise and improve thermal performance over time, while the share of freehold and long lease reduce ownership costs and uncertainty.
